The Garden of Words is a beautiful short film about loneliness and love and longing, inspired by verses from the Manyoshu, an anthology of ancient Japanese poems:
A faint clap of thunder
Clouded skies
Perhaps rain will come
If so, will you stay here with me?A faint clap of thunder
Even if rain comes or not
I will stay here
Together with you.
Rain is a central motif in the film. Like the force of love, it can’t be controlled or stopped.

The Garden of Words
A 15-year-old boy and 27-year-old woman find an unlikely friendship one rainy day in the Shinjuku Gyoen National Garden.Director: Makoto Shinkai
Cast: Miyu Irino, Kana Hanazawa, Fumi Hirano, Gou Maeda
